Seth Grae
Lightbridge

Seth Grae leads Lightbridge Corporation’s efforts to develop nuclear fuel technology to improve the safety, economics, and proliferation resistance of existing and new power reactors, including small modular reactors. Lightbridge’s proprietary fuel technology promises to make nuclear power - a reliable source of carbon-free electricity -more competitive. Seth also led Lightbridge’s advisory roles to governments of countries seeking to start or expand nuclear power programs, from feasibility studies through procurement and operations. Lightbridge developed the United Arab Emirates’ strategic plan for commercial nuclear energy. Seth oversees the company’s recruitment of world-class experts. Lightbridge engineers invented the fuel and the fuel’s manufacturing method, and Lightbridge holds worldwide patents. Seth is a frequent guest speaker at universities and at international conferences on energy, nuclear power and the environment. He is a member of the U.S. Commerce Secretary’s advisory committee on international trade issues facing the nuclear power industry and is a member of the board of directors of the Nuclear Energy Institute. He also has experience taking the company public on the Nasdaq stock exchange and in guiding the company through litigation and arbitration.

Michael Sullivan
Champion Energy Services

Michael Sullivan serves as President & Chief Executive Officer. Michael served as Chief Operating Officer for Champion Energy from 2010 to 2015. Prior to joining Champion Energy, Michael was a founding partner of Ambridge Energy, LLC, which merged with Champion Energy in 2008. Prior to founding Ambridge, he held several operations and marketing support roles at Reliant Energy between 2002 and 2007. Michael's career began at Andersen Consulting and later spent several years at Arthur Andersen. He earned a Bachelor of Science in Finance from the University of South Alabama and a Master of Business Administration from Baylor University.
